Snack Stash: A Typeface Bursting with Flavor

There are fonts that simply sit on the page, doing their job of communicating text without much fuss. And then there are typefaces that practically leap off the screen, radiating energy and personality. If your current project feels a bit flat, a bit too corporate, or simply in need of a spark, it might be time to explore a display font that doesn't whisper, but shouts with joy. This is where a bold, playful option like Snack Stash enters the conversation, offering a design language that is unmistakably vibrant and full of life.

Snack Stash is a premium display font designed to capture attention and infuse projects with a sense of fun and creativity. Its visual character is defined by its bold, rounded forms and a distinctively playful flair. It doesn't aim for understated elegance; instead, it embraces a more exuberant, statement-making aesthetic. The letterforms often feature a slight bounce or irregularity, giving it a handcrafted, approachable feel that resonates with audiences looking for warmth and authenticity. This typeface is built for headlines, logos, and any application where you want the typography itself to be a focal point and evoke a positive, energetic response.

Injecting Personality into Your Visual Identity

For small business owners and entrepreneurs, building a memorable brand identity is crucial. The fonts you choose are a silent ambassador for your brand's voice. Snack Stash, with its lively and inventive character, is particularly suited for brands that position themselves as friendly, youthful, innovative, or family-oriented. Think of a local bakery with a playful menu, a children's educational app, a boutique ice cream parlor, or a creative workshop studio. Using a typeface like this for your logo or primary branding elements can instantly communicate that your brand is approachable, energetic, and not afraid to stand out. It helps build brand recognition because its unique style is hard to forget.

However, matching typography to your project goals is key. A bold display font like Snack Stash is a powerful tool, but it’s not a one-size-fits-all solution. It shines brightest when used for short, impactful text—think a catchy slogan on a poster, the title of a social media graphic, or the name of a product on its packaging. Using it for long paragraphs of body text would likely hinder readability. The practical advice here is to pair it with a more neutral, highly legible font for supporting text. A clean sans-serif or a simple serif font can provide a perfect counterbalance, ensuring your main message pops while the details remain easy to read.

From Packaging to Pixels: Real-World Applications

The true test of a creative font is its versatility across different mediums. Snack Stash excels in applications where visual impact is paramount. In packaging design, it can make a product stand out on a crowded shelf, especially for items in the food, beverage, or lifestyle sectors. Imagine it on a bag of artisan popcorn, a bottle of craft soda, or a box of colorful stationery—it immediately sets a tone of fun and quality.

In the digital realm, its applications are just as potent. For social media graphics on platforms like Instagram or Pinterest, a headline set in Snack Stash can stop the scroll and increase engagement. It's perfect for creating eye-catching quotes, event announcements, or promotional offers. For bloggers and content creators, using it for blog post titles or chapter headings in a digital product (like an eBook or online course) can add a unique stylistic touch that enhances the reader's experience. Similarly, for website design, it can be used strategically for hero section text or call-to-action buttons to inject personality, provided the overall site layout remains clean and navigable.

Practical Considerations for Seamless Integration

When integrating any new font into your workflow, a few practical steps ensure success. First, always test font pairings before committing. Create mockups of your logo, a social media post, and a webpage header to see how Snack Stash interacts with your chosen body text font. Check the contrast in weight and style to ensure harmony, not competition.

Second, consider readability across different sizes and backgrounds. A display font's charm can diminish if it becomes illegible at small sizes or on a busy background. Test it on both light and dark backgrounds, and at various scales, to find its sweet spot. Third, review the full character set and included font styles. Does the typeface include numbers, punctuation, and extended Latin characters if needed? Does it come with a regular and bold weight? Understanding the full package helps you plan its use more effectively.

Finally, for any commercial project, licensing is non-negotiable. Ensure you are acquiring a commercial license for the font that covers your intended use, whether it's for client work, merchandise for sale, or digital products. Reputable font marketplaces and foundries provide clear licensing terms, giving you peace of mind to use the font in your professional endeavors.
